4 takeaways from the U.S. men’s final tune-up games before the World Cup
RSS SUMMARY · AGGREGATED FROM NPR
The U.S. men's national team chose to play a pair of highly-ranked, super competitive teams in the final lead-up to the World Cup: Senegal and Germany. The matches showed the U.S. is ready.
